ASROCK B850M: UEFI boot freeze after bootloader load

running a small server system with most recent CURRENT on an AM5 mainboard ASROCK B850M Pro-A,
the last working firmware with FreeBSD seems to be 3.50. Upgrading to 4.03 (with some minor
optimizations for JEDEC/memory specs and preliminary support for upcominng AMD Zen5 CPUs)
leaves the system with the initial loader message dumping some informations about the used
screen resolutions in a frozen state. Not keyboard (USB), nothing, the box is dead.
I also tried the latest flash image provided by snapshot service,
FreeBSD-16.0-CURRENT-amd64-20260126-8ef8c6abfadf-283376-memstick.img. Same result. The same
with the official 15.0-RELEASE USB flashdrive or 15-STABLE snapshot.

I tried an older Ubuntu (EFi boot), which worked. Maybe this is a minor issue.
